Transaction 57e94564af2a70f7edd10aeccfa5e1dcfe740cecfb854febcbce092157210027
1 Input
1 Output
-
57e94564af2a70f7edd10aeccfa5e1dcfe740cecfb854febcbce092157210027:0
- value
- 422675
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dd06cb5382cc7aa1853738af49085316ca4497e3 OP_EQUAL
- address
- 3MqhQ1ZmeBWt3nT5EfWvvTZTUPSjXL3WEG